Monday. The 24 planetary hours for Bengaluru, computed from the local sunrise and sunset (day and night hours are unequal by season).

Benefic horās today: Moon 06:09–07:09; Jupiter 08:10–09:10; Venus 11:10–12:10; Mercury 12:10–13:10; Moon 13:10–14:10; Jupiter 15:11–16:11 (IST). Sunrise 06:09 · sunset 18:11, Bengaluru.

Jupiter, Venus, Mercury and the Moon rule the classically benefic hours; the Sun, Mars, Saturn hours are treated as malefic for new undertakings. See also the Bengaluru Choghaḍiyā and the full Bengaluru panchāṅga for 27 September 2027.

How this table was computed

Method12 day hours (sunrise→sunset) and 12 night hours (sunset→next sunrise), unequal by season; the sequence runs in the Chaldean order starting from the weekday lord's hour (classical derivation); sunrise/sunset from Swiss Ephemeris
